What Is TMJ Disorder TMD?

TMJ disorder, often referred to as TMD, affects millions of individuals and can lead to significant discomfort. This condition involves dysfunction of the temporomandibular joint, which connects the jawbone to the skull. The causes of TMD are varied and may include clenching and grinding of teeth, arthritis, or injury to the jaw. Symptoms can range from mild to severe, impacting daily activities such as eating, speaking, and even sleeping. Common Symptoms You Shouldn't Ignore

Recognizing the symptoms of TMD is essential for timely intervention. Common signs include persistent jaw pain, facial muscle tension, headaches, and difficulty opening or closing the mouth. Some patients also experience clicking or popping sounds when moving their jaws. If these symptoms resonate, it’s vital to address them promptly. Ignoring these warning signals could lead to more complex issues down the line.

Treatment Options for Jaw Pain

When it comes to TMJ treatment, several options exist depending on the severity of the condition. For mild cases, conservative approaches such as over-the-counter pain relievers, ice packs, and relaxation techniques may provide relief. More advanced treatments might involve custom night guards to prevent clenching and grinding during sleep, physical therapy to strengthen jaw muscles, or even injections to reduce inflammation. In some instances, surgical interventions may be necessary, but these are typically considered a last resort.

Lifestyle Tips to Manage TMJ at Home

In addition to professional treatment, there are numerous lifestyle changes individuals can adopt to manage TMJ symptoms at home. Regularly practicing stress-reduction techniques, such as yoga or meditation, can help alleviate facial muscle tension. Maintaining a soft diet and avoiding hard or chewy foods can minimize strain on the jaw. Gentle jaw exercises prescribed by Dr. Renken can improve mobility and reduce discomfort. Staying hydrated and maintaining good posture also play critical roles in managing jaw pain effectively.

Q1 What Causes TMJ to Flare Up Suddenly?

Sudden flare-ups of TMJ pain can result from various factors, including increased stress levels leading to clenching and grinding, recent dental work, or injuries to the jaw area. Identifying triggers is essential for effective management.

Q2 Is TMJ Permanent or Treatable?

While TMJ disorders can be chronic, they are often treatable. Many patients find significant relief through appropriate interventions and lifestyle adjustments. With the right approach, many individuals can manage their symptoms effectively.
